Can I take over-the-counter medicine during radiation treatment for cancer?

Be sure to ask your radiation oncologist or nurse before taking any medicine even over-the-counter medications. This includes aspirin. You should list all medicines you are currently taking and any allergies you may have and discuss it with your radiation oncologist.
